I think the best thing to do is wire tie the pump open full instead of having it throttle controlled, and adding maybe an ounce of oil to the tank. It's kinda tough to gauge what to add since your essentially thinning out your gas w/o knowing exactly what the pump puts out at what point in the throttle position. I'm running a stock bore and still pulled my oil injection pump and res just to have more control of my fuel mixture. I run 32:1 which is fairly standard advice from the more knowledgeable guys on here. It's amazing how much more oil you use when you premix, even at 50:1. That pump doesn't put out that much oil, at least not on my aero 50 or my brothers zuma.

The ammount of oil is depended upon how high you're going to rev your engine. Low revvers need only 2%. 10k needs 3%, 12k singers need 4%. It's directly related to rpm and hp.
